All MCC Employees Are Invited to Participate in Scholars' Day 2025

Are you an MCC employee (faculty, staff, or administrator) looking for a venue to present your scholarly research or give an artistic performance?  Did you know that Scholars' Day at MCC showcases the work of professional researchers in addition to that of our student scholars?  This event celebrates academic excellence while promoting and encouraging scholarship throughout the College. If you are conducting research or scholarship of any kind, whether as part of a degree program, for professional reasons, or out of personal interest, we encourage you to consider presenting it at Scholars' Day 2025.

Additionally, you can participate in the event by encouraging students to participate or by mentoring their research projects.  You could also build Scholars' Day into your curriculum and promote student attendance as a classroom assignment.  Please consider getting involved or attending to support our students at Scholars' Day in the spring!

Scholars' Day 2025 will be held on Tuesday, April 29 on the Brighton Campus.  Additionally, on Wednesday, April 30 the Scholars' Day Celebration of Learning will be held in the LeRoy V. Good Library from 3 to 4:30 PM, followed by a keynote presentation from Clint Smith at 7 PM in the MCC Theatre.

All students and employees are invited to submit an application to deliver an oral or poster presentation, or a performance at Scholars' Day (see our FAQ for details); application forms are available now. The application deadline is March 3, 2025.
